Towing
rl
It the car needs to be towed, call a professional towingservice. Never tow the car behind another car with just
a rope or chain. lt is very dange.ous.
Emergency Towing
There are three popular methods of towing a car:
Flat-bed Equipmont-The operator loads the car on theback of a truck. This is the best way of transporting thecar.
Whsol Lift Equipment-The tow truck uses two oivot-ing arms that go under the tires (front or rear) and liftsthem otf the ground. The other two wheels remain onthe ground.
Sling-type Equipmont-The tow truck uses metal cableswith hooks on the ends. These hooks go around partsof the frame or suspension and the cables lift that endof the car off the ground. The car's suspension and bodvcan be seriously damaged if this method of towing is at-tempted.
It the car cannot be transponed by flat-bed, it should betowed with the tfont wheels oft the ground. lf due todamage. the car must be towed with the front wheelson the ground, do the tollowing:
Manual Transmission
a Release the parking brake,a Shift the transmission to Neutral.
Automatic Transmission
a Release the parking brake.a Start the engine.
a Shift to @ oosition, then to S position.
a Turn off the engine.
NOTICE: lmproper towing preparation will damage thetransmission. Follow the above procedure exactly. lf you
cannot shift the transmission or stan the engine (auto-
matic transmission), your car must be transDorted on aflat-bed.
a lt is best to tow the car no tarther than SO miles lgokm). and keep the speed below 3b mph (bE km/h).
NOTICE: Trying to litt or tow your car by the bumperswill cause serious damage. The bumpers are not designedto support the car's weight.
